What Happened
Software République, an open-innovation ecosystem created in 2021, brings together Atos, Dassault Systèmes, JCDecaux, Renault Group, STMicroelectronics, and Thales to develop intelligent and sustainable mobility solutions. Over five years, it has grown from a concept into a platform delivering tangible technologies.

The newest solution, cleveR insights, aggregates data from vehicles and sensors to provide decision-support tools for local authorities. Unveiled on 12 June 2026, it represents the next phase of the ecosystem's focus on solving real-world challenges.

Terms in This Story
- Open innovation
- A collaborative approach where companies share knowledge and resources to develop new technologies.
- Bidirectional charging
- A charging system that allows energy to flow both from the grid to a vehicle and from the vehicle back to the grid.
